How our load-based pricing works

Load-based pricing means we charge by the amount of van space your items occupy. Typical load sizes we use are:

  • Small van load — ideal for single-room clearances or small flat declutters.
  • Transit/Large van load — good for two-bedroom flats, bulky furniture from Dulwich Village homes.
  • Luton/Multiple loads — for full-flat clearances or bulk removals from properties near Denmark Hill and busy residential streets.

We convert estimated loads to cubic yards for clients who prefer volumetric pricing: one small van load is roughly 4–6 cubic yards, a transit about 8–12 cubic yards, and a Luton can be 15+ cubic yards depending on stacking. Rubbish company prices in the Dulwich area — what affects cost

Several factors influence prices across rubbish companies locally. We state them clearly:

  • Volume — measured by load or cubic yards. Bigger volume = higher disposal and vehicle time.
  • Labour — number of crew and time on site, especially for heavy items (pianos, beds, sofas).
  • Access — narrow staircases, long carry distances, or permit-required parking add time.
  • Type of waste — general household waste is standard; hazardous items, fridge/freezer disposal or asbestos add legal-handling charges.

Sample quick-reference price bands

Use these ballpark numbers when comparing options. They are illustrative — a free quote will give your exact figure.

  • Small van load: £70–£140 (studio or single-room)
  • Transit/medium load: £120–£220 (one-bedroom flat or several bulky items)
  • Large/Luton load: £220–£600+ (two-bedroom or full clearances; multiple trips possible)
  • Cubic-yard pricing (for bulky mixed waste): approx £20–£40 per cubic yard depending on material and disposal fees
